| Crockpot applesauce. Peel and core apples, throw in crock pot, add cinnamon and vanilla. Set it and forget it. I make tons of it in hopes of freezing, but somehow it always gets consumed first. |

I make an apple Dutch Baby that is really easy and pretty healthy
6 T butter 2 t. cinnamon 1/4 c. brown sugar 2 apples, sliced thin 4 eggs 1 cup milk 1 cup flour Powdered sugar Melt butter in a cast iron pan (10" or so) and stir in cinnamon and sugar. Add apples and cook, stirring, about 5 minutes. Put the pan, uncovered, in 425 degree oven while you mix the batter, about 5 minutes. Mix eggs and flour until smooth. Add in milk. Pour batter over apples in pan. Bake, uncovered, until pancake is puffy and golden, about 15 minutes. Let the pancake stand about 5 minutes. Cut into wedges and dust with powdered sugar. |
